2 stars Xinema plays a basic neo-prog music tinted with some heavy sounds as more bands of this genre are experiencing nowadays (Talk).

One can think that the two long suite type of songs will be different. Especially while one is listening to the symphonic music available during the intro Awakening of the first of them (Speak To The World). But the band reverts to its neo style rather quickly.

Actually, the shortest parts of this suite are the ones that differs most: symphonic for the first one, classical for the second. What goes around these is not bad; but lacks of character. Only the closing part from Communication is slightly better thanks to the work from Sven Larsson on the guitar. I would have been glad to listen to more moments like this one (same scheme for Life The Way I Knew It).

There aren't any improvement during the second long piece of this album: Ghost Of A Memory starts on some easy listening but heavy neo-prog (Nothing). The fourth part is even flirting with some metal riffs. I can not be laudatory about this album: there are really too few good songs in here to be an enjoyable affair.

Average is the word that best describes this Basic Communication. The only standout moments are the excellent guitar breaks from Sven. Two stars and pretty basic indeed.
